    Default Aqib Talib, Broncos CB, named AFC Defensive Player of the Week

    After recording a season-high eight tackles and snagging an interception to seal a 22-10 win against San Diego on Sunday, Denver Broncos cornerback Aqib Talib was named the AFC Defensive Player of the Week.

    It’s the second time the 28-year-old has received the honor. He won the NFC award with Tampa Bay in 2010.

    This is the 27th time a Broncos player has earned the AFC Defensive Player of the Week award, and first since Dominique Rodgers-Cromartie won it last season.

    Default Upon Further Review: Broncos-Chargers

    The play that effectively sealed the Broncos' fourth consecutive AFC West title was one of many examples of a defensive game plan that kept the Chargers off-balance from start to finish.

    And it was all about cornerback Aqib Talib watching Philip Rivers and suckering the Pro Bowl quarterback into a throw to wide receiver Malcom Floyd, who ran a route that is usually the Bolts' most reliable tool, but in this case was their undoing: the dig.

    "We just know Rivers loves to throw digs," said Chris Harris Jr. "He threw me a dig the first game and he came back and threw Talib a dig so that was great film study by him.
    AND
    "I looked at Philip the whole time," said Talib. "He probably thought we were in man (coverage), but we [were] not."

    "I was just undercut [the route] and it really was (Defensive Coordinator) Jack (Del Rio). It really was Jack. He called a great call."
